Types of Roofing Products



Choosing the best roof product is important for both the looks and resilience of your home. You've got several options, each with its own advantages and downsides.

Asphalt tiles are the most popular choice as a result of their affordability and very easy installment. They come in different shades and designs, making it easy to match your home's exterior.

Metal roof covering is one more superb alternative, known for its durability and resistance to severe climate condition. While it may come with a higher preliminary cost, its sturdiness typically leads to savings in the long run.

If you're seeking a much more green option, take into consideration tiles made from recycled materials or perhaps an eco-friendly roofing with living plants.

Clay and concrete floor tiles provide a distinctive, traditional appearance that improves aesthetic allure. Nevertheless, they can be hefty and might call for additional architectural support.

If you prefer an unique look, slate roof supplies an extravagant surface however can be fairly costly and challenging to install.

Inevitably, your selection ought to show your budget plan, climate, and personal design. Take your time to evaluate the pros and cons before making a final decision.

Understanding Labor Expenses



Labor expenses can dramatically impact the total cost of your roof covering task. When you work with a service provider, you're not simply spending for their time; you're also covering their knowledge and the skills of their team. Generally, labor prices can represent 60% to 70% of your complete roofing expenses, so comprehending these prices is important.

Different factors influence labor expenses. The intricacy of your roofing system plays a large duty-- steeper roof coverings or those with numerous aspects call for even more ability and time, bring about higher labor expenses.

Geographic location issues too; service providers in urban locations typically charge more because of greater need and living prices.


It's additionally crucial to take into consideration the service provider's experience and track record. While you might find less costly options, going with a reputable professional can save you cash over time by decreasing the risk of errors and making certain quality workmanship.

When you get price quotes, see to it to break down the expenses to see how much is assigned for labor. This way, you'll have a more clear image and can budget plan appropriately, ensuring your roofing task remains on track economically.
